摘要
We report on the charge transfer in intercalated C-60 peapods as a function of doping. A competition between a charge transfer to the SWCNT pods and one to the C60 peas is observed. At low intercalation levels the charge transfer is predominantly to the SWCNT pods. This leads to. a shift of the Fermi level beyond the third van Hove singularity of the semiconducting tubes for potassium intercalation (n-doping) and beyond the first singularity of the metallic tubes for FeCl3 intercalation (p-doping), respectively. In addition at high levels of potassium intercalation the C-60 pods are charged up to C-60(6-) and form a metallic one dimensional polymer.
